Common Admission Requirements For Sterile Processing Technology SchoolsIn Alexandria, Louisiana
Admission to Sterile Processing Technology programs in Alexandria typically requires meeting several key prerequisites:
High School Diploma or GED: Applicants must have completed secondary education.
Prerequisite Coursework: Some programs may require classes in biology, chemistry, or math prior to enrollment.
Background Check: Given the sensitive nature of healthcare work, students may need to pass a criminal background check.
CPR Certification: Many programs expect applicants to hold current CPR certification, as this is essential for working in healthcare settings.
Health Documentation: Students may be required to provide immunization records or undergo health screenings, ensuring they are fit for clinical environments.
Application Process: Interested candidates should complete the school’s specific application forms, which may include essays or personal statements that highlight their interest in sterile processing.

Cost & Financial Aid Options For Sterile Processing Technology Schools In Alexandria, Louisiana
Tuition costs for Sterile Processing Technology programs in Alexandria, Louisiana, vary based on the institution and the program's length. Here’s a general overview:
Tuition Ranges: Programs can typically cost between $5,000 to $15,000 for the entire course. Community colleges may offer lower tuition rates, while technical schools may charge higher fees for more specialized training.
Financial Aid Options: Students can explore various financial aid resources, including:
- Federal Student Aid: Completing the FAFSA can determine eligibility for federal grants, loans, and work-study programs.
- State Scholarships: Louisiana offers state-specific scholarships for residents enrolled in healthcare programs.
- Institutional Scholarships: Many schools have financial aid offices that provide scholarships based on merit or need.
- Work-Study Programs: Opportunities may exist to work within the institution or affiliated healthcare facilities to offset tuition costs.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) About Sterile Processing Technology Schools In Alexandria, Louisiana
What is Sterile Processing Technology?
- It is a field that focuses on cleaning, sterilizing, and managing medical instruments and supplies used in healthcare settings.
What qualifications do I need to enter a program?
- Generally, a high school diploma or GED, completion of prerequisite coursework, and a successful background check.
Are there online Sterile Processing Technology programs?
- Some programs may offer online coursework, but hands-on training is typically required.
What certification is required to work in this field?
- Certification from recognized bodies, such as the Certification Board for Sterile Processing and Distribution (CBSPD), is often required or strongly recommended.
How long does it take to complete a Sterile Processing Technology program?
- Most programs range from 9 months to 2 years, depending on the type of certification pursued.
What is the average salary for a sterile processing technician in Louisiana?
- The average salary ranges from $30,000 to $45,000, depending on experience and the specific employer.
Is job experience necessary before applying?
- Many programs do not require prior job experience, but it can be beneficial.
How important is continuing education in this field?
- Continuing education is essential, as maintaining certification often requires ongoing training and professional development.
